Sandara Park has turned her attention to Japanese study after embracing gyaru makeup. The 42-year-old singer shared several photos on her social media account on Sept. 6.

In the images, she worked carefully through a workbook that teaches learners to write hiragana, the Japanese script. Her focused appearance conveyed a strong sense of dedication.

A book titled โ€œFirst Stepโ€ could be seen beneath the notebook, suggesting that she has only recently begun studying. The photos presented the singer concentrating on the basics as she takes her first steps with the language.
